Tabbi’s Kats (42) vs. Cincinnati Bagels (41)
In what may be the most thrilling finish of the week, Tabbi’s Kats edged out the Cincinnati Bagels, 42-41, in a nail-biter. Derrick Henry and D’Andre Swift were the dual-wielding hammers for the Kats, combining for 203 rushing yards and 2 TDs. "We’re just out here running downhill, no one can stop us," Henry said as he jogged off the field, looking like a human bulldozer.
Cincinnati was close—so close. Roschon Johnson scored two rushing touchdowns and Darnell Mooney made everyone remember who he is with 105 yards and 2 TDs, but it just wasn’t enough. "We were right there!" Sam Darnold shouted in the locker room, likely while staring at a wall and wondering what went wrong. "Maybe if I had thrown one more pass…or two."
